Master your music production skills. Explore advanced production techniques to work with both MIDI and audio clips. This class is taught by Melrose Center Instructors.
Use tempo rulers, conductor tracks, quantizing and transposition to create polished audio within Pro Tools.
Required Skills: Ability to navigate, edit, and route audio within Pro Tools. Understanding of the MIDI language and digital audio theory, including sample rate and bit depth.
Recommended Prerequisites: Pro Tools Levels 1 - 4, Fundamentals of Sound for Audio Engineering
Recommended Audience: Adults
